Pukeko Pictures Invests in Storytelling with BeyondTheStory

Wellington, February 4 2015 - New Zealand’s Pukeko Pictures has today announced investment in the New Zealand and London-based digital company, BeyondTheStory.

BeyondTheStory is a digital company specialising in interactive technology using its breakthrough technology Publisher+. This software platform allows users to easily and quickly create their own eBook as an interactive app on all formats and devices, from simple eBooks to immersive apps and even to traditional printing.

The first initiative between the two companies will be a collection of The WotWots educational eBooks to accompany the much-loved preschool television series and promote learning through the fun of creative play and storytelling.

Co-Owner of Pukeko Pictures and Weta Workshop, Sir Richard Taylor said: “BeyondTheStory has developed a highly imaginative way to work with our assets to create episode-by-episode quests and expand feature storylines. I look forward to working with BeyondTheStory to design and create an inspirational digital app world that will engage the imagination of audiences worldwide.’’ he said.

CEO of Pukeko Pictures, Andrew Smith said: “We are delighted to be working with fellow Kiwi company BeyondTheStory. We feel very confident to invest in the company and the potential this brings for us, both in New Zealand and the UK. For Pukeko Pictures, it’s not just about the unique technology that BeyondTheStory has developed but the shared philosophy of bringing the magic of storytelling to viewers worldwide.”

CEO of BeyondTheStory, Jen Porter said: “We are delighted Pukeko Pictures has united in our quest to expand the storytelling experience through television and tablet. This investment gives BeyondTheStory and Pukeko Pictures the opportunity to collaborate on exciting projects. Given that we began our journey in Wellington, I feel akin ‘to the return home’, yet remaining in London as we scale both companies internationally”.

About Pukeko Pictures
Pukeko Pictures is an independent entertainment production company focused on the development and production of excellent quality multi-platform entertainment for a global audience. Pukeko Pictures was formed in 2008 by Sir Richard Taylor, Tania Rodger and Martin Baynton, and is located in Wellington, New Zealand. With a connection to the world famous Weta Workshop (Avatar, King Kong, Lord of the Rings), Pukeko Pictures is uniquely positioned in the creation of world-leading entertainment, harnessing the best in global talent and world-class production processes.

About BeyondTheStory
BeyondTheStory is a New Zealand London-based UK digital company, a master of rich, interactive storytelling. Its breakthrough technology. Since its migration to the UK in 2009, BeyondTheStory has been perfecting its technology to meet the imperative that screens must be interactive and media rich. It has developed the first automated software platform, Publisher + that enables fast and cost effective production of interactive 3D books, eBooks and apps. BeyondTheStory apps are available on the App Store, and eBooks on the iBookstore.
